The Evolution of Machine Learning Algorithms
Machine learning algorithms have evolved from simple linear regression models to complex deep learning networks. This evolution has been fueled by the availability of large datasets and increased computational power. Today, algorithms can learn from data in ways that were unimaginable a decade ago.
Key Advancements in Recent Years
Among the most significant advancements are the development of algorithms that can process and learn from unstructured data, such as images and text. Techniques like neural networks and deep learning have opened new frontiers in machine learning.
- Improved accuracy in predictive models
- Greater efficiency in processing large datasets
- Enhanced ability to learn from minimal supervision
Applications of Advanced Machine Learning Algorithms
The applications of these advanced algorithms are vast. In healthcare, they're being used to predict patient outcomes and personalize treatment plans. In the automotive industry, they power the self-driving cars of the future. The possibilities are endless, and we're just scratching the surface.
Challenges and Future Directions
Despite these advancements, challenges remain. Issues such as data privacy, algorithmic bias, and the need for massive computational resources are hurdles that the field must overcome. However, the future looks bright, with ongoing research focused on making algorithms more efficient, transparent, and accessible.
